| Description | Monitoring
the quality of The Scout Association’s Adult Training Scheme.
|
| Required by |
Others
|
| Relevant to |
Those wishing to undertake this role
|
| Learning methods available |
External Course Course
|
| Aim | To
provide the skills, knowledge and attitudes necessary to monitor the
quality of The Scout Association’s Adult Training Scheme.
|
| Topics that this module covers are |
Sampling of portfolios Quality control
|
| This means |
Acting as a moderator for the scheme. Knowing how to sample portfolios. Being ably to assess standards. Being able to implement quality control.
|
| Questions |
Do you understand the process of moderation? Can you review portfolios and learning to assess standards? Can you describe The Scout Association’s quality control methods?
|
| To validate this module the learner will need to complete two of the following |
An
NOCN course, NVQ assessment or similar.
Further details are available in the Guide to the Open College
Network.
